What Are Carbon Steel Silos?
Carbon steel silos are cylindrical storage containers made from carbon steel, a versatile material known for its strength and durability. These silos are typically used to store grains, seeds, and other agricultural products and are designed to withstand a variety of environmental conditions. Unlike traditional storage methods, carbon steel silos maintain the quality of stored products while also allowing for efficient inventory management.

Installing Carbon Steel Silos: A Step-by-Step Guide
The installation of carbon steel silos is a crucial step that requires careful planning and execution. Here’s a general guide to help farmers through the installation process:
1. Assess Your Needs
Before installing a carbon steel silo, it's essential to evaluate your storage requirements. Consider the types of crops you will store, the quantity, and the frequency of access.
2. Choose the Right Location
Selecting an appropriate site for the silo is critical. The location should provide easy access for trucks and machinery while being away from flood-prone areas.
3. Prepare the Site
Once a location is chosen, prepare the site by leveling the ground and ensuring proper drainage. This step is vital to maintain the structural integrity of the silo.
4. Follow Manufacturer Guidelines
Refer to the manufacturer's guidelines for installation procedures. This may include securing the silo to a concrete foundation to enhance stability.
5. Safety Measures
During installation, prioritize safety by ensuring that workers are equipped with proper safety gear and that all equipment is functioning correctly.
6. Final Inspection
After installation, conduct a thorough inspection to ensure that the silo is correctly assembled and functioning as intended.
Frequently Asked Questions
1. What are the typical sizes of carbon steel silos?
Carbon steel silos come in various sizes ranging from small units capable of holding a few tons to large silos that can store thousands of tons of grain. The size you choose will depend on your storage needs.
2. Are carbon steel silos customizable?
Yes, many manufacturers offer customization options for carbon steel silos to meet specific storage requirements, including height, diameter, and additional features like aeration systems.
3. How do I maintain carbon steel silos?
Maintenance for carbon steel silos includes regular inspections for rust or corrosion, ensuring seals are intact, and checking for any structural damage. Proper maintenance will prolong the life of the silo.
4. Can carbon steel silos be used for different types of crops?
Absolutely! Carbon steel silos are versatile and can be used to store various agricultural products, including grains, seeds, animal feed, and even some fertilizers.
5. What is the cost of installing a carbon steel silo?
The cost of installing a carbon steel silo can vary significantly based on factors such as size, location, and additional features. However, the long-term savings on maintenance and crop preservation often justify the initial investment.
